Info from Sal What is a blood feather? A blood feather is a feather that is filled with blood. Blood feathers are a normal part of budgie feather growth and replacement. They can be easily identified on the underside of the wing by red inside the feather shaft. Some birds have more problems with blood feathers than others do. If a blood feather is damaged it can cause bleeding which can be very serious. It is best to wait until after a molt to trim wing feathers so that any blood feathers have a chance to grow into full feathers.
